The view from the Ford’s Theatre stage looking out to the audience. To the left of the stage is the President Box with an American flag, a framed picture of George Washington and American flag bunting draped over the box. To the right is another box with yellow and white curtains. In the center of the stage is a wooden desk. The view includes two levels of seating and rows of lighting equipment on the third level.

Social Media and Marketing Manager

Job Summary: Leads the creation and implementation of the organization’s social media strategy. Assists with creation and implementation of advertising, direct marketing, digital marketing and promotional campaigns related to the theatre, historic site, education and development. Assists with soliciting media and businesses for sponsorship, cross-promotion and trade agreements.

Principal Responsibilities

Social Media 

  • Create, maintain, monitor and analyze the organization’s social media content calendar and strategies, serving as primary lead on Facebook, TikTok, Instagram, YouTube and other platforms as needs arise
  • Continue integration of history and programing content across all social media platforms with assigned KPIs  
  • Report metrics, key performance indicators and tracking reports for social media initiatives 
  • Write original social media copy that engages history and theatre fans while also aligning with the Ford’s Theatre interpretive plan, communicate donor impact/benefits, raises profile of education programming and drives ticket sales 
  • Serve as Social Media Committee chairperson, developing monthly editorial calendar with cross-departmental Social Media Committee
  • Evaluate potential new social media platforms and make recommendations as to how they may or may not fit in with institutional priorities 
  • Monitor online feedback, drafting responses when necessary or appropriate to reviews and comments on Facebook, Instagram, Google Business, TripAdvisor, Yelp, etc. 
  • Recommend and implement strategies for achieving Website Content Accessibility Standards in social media content
